A self-hosted, Overleaf-style collaborative LaTeX workspace that your own AI coding agent can read, edit, and compile — over a single URL + token.
Overleaf is great for writing papers with people, but it locks your manuscript inside a SaaS that your LLM cannot reach. Quillo flips that: it is a real-time LaTeX editor and a clean HTTP API designed so that the agent you already use — Claude Code, Codex CLI, Cursor, or any tool that can send an HTTP request — can open your paper, fix the bibliography, rewrite a section, compile to PDF, and leave review comments, all without copy-pasting .tex files back and forth.
You bring your own model. Quillo just makes the paper reachable.
The front door: sign in to your own instance. The terminal on the right is the actual API loop an agent runs — take the lock, edit a .tex file, compile, unlock — using the same account you log in with.
The editor: a multi-file project (main.tex pulling in sections/*.tex via \input, a figure under figures/), LaTeX source with syntax highlighting, and a live xelatex PDF preview — the same project an agent edits over the API.

- Bring-your-own-LLM. No vendor AI lock-in. Any agent with a bearer token can drive the editor through a documented REST API. The agent can even fetch its own instructions:
GET /api/papers/{key}/guidereturns a Markdown playbook. - Human + agent on the same document. A 30-minute edit lock keeps a human and an agent from clobbering each other. Review comments don't need the lock, so an agent can leave suggestions while you keep typing.
- Real LaTeX, real PDFs. Server-side
xelatex(Unicode-native, CJK-friendly) with optionalbibtex. Every compile auto-snapshots changed files into version history with line-level diffs. - Self-hosted & private. SQLite + local file storage. Your manuscripts never leave your machine. Clone, run, done.
- Batteries included. 26 LaTeX templates, image uploads, project ZIP export, collaborator invites, and draft → submitted → revision → published status tracking.
Requirements: Python 3.11+, Node 18+, and (for PDF compilation) a TeX distribution providing xelatex — e.g. TeX Live or MacTeX. bibtex is optional.

The first boot seeds one admin from QUILLO_ADMIN_EMAIL / QUILLO_ADMIN_PASSWORD (defaults admin@quillo.local / change-me-quillo — change them). Everyone else self-registers:
- A visitor opens Sign up (
/register) and creates an account — it starts aspending. - Pending accounts cannot log in yet (login returns
403). - An admin approves them under Manage users (
/admin/users) → the account becomesactiveand can sign in. Admins can also reject a registration or remove a member.
This keeps a self-hosted instance closed by default: anyone can ask for access, but only an admin lets them in. (Embedding Quillo in a host app bypasses all of this — the host's auth is used instead.)

This is the part Overleaf can't do. Any agent that can make HTTP requests becomes a co-author.
The API button in the editor opens "External API access": it shows this paper's API URL, lets you issue/revoke a personal token, and gives you a ready-to-paste prompt for an agent. Hand the agent just the URL + token — it discovers everything else from the in-app guide. External edits obey the same lock model, so writes are rejected (423) while someone else is editing.
In the web UI, issue a token (or call the API directly). The raw token is shown once — store it securely.

All write operations require holding the edit lock; writing without it is rejected with 423.
POST /api/papers/{key}/lock # acquire lock (409 if someone else holds it)
GET /api/papers/{key}/files # list files [{id, path, kind}]
GET /api/papers/{key}/files/{file_id} # read content
PUT /api/papers/{key}/files/{file_id} # replace content {"content": "..."}
POST /api/papers/{key}/files # create file {"path","kind","content"}
POST /api/papers/{key}/compile # xelatex → PDF (422 + log on error)
POST /api/papers/{key}/unlock # release lock when done
The lock auto-expires after 30 minutes and renews on each save. On a compile error the endpoint returns 422 with the LaTeX log — the agent reads the ! lines, fixes the source, and recompiles. Every compile snapshots changed files into history (GET /history, line-level diffs, restore).
Comments don't need the lock, so an agent can critique while a human writes:
GET /api/papers/{key}/comments?file_id={id} # status: open | resolved
POST /api/papers/{key}/comments # {"file_id","quote","anchor","body"}
PUT /api/papers/{key}/comments/{id} # {"status":"resolved"}
- The entry point is always
main.tex. Don't delete bundled.sty/.clsfiles. - Images upload via multipart
POST /files/upload(jpg/png/gif/webp/pdf/eps, ≤ 20 MB). - Compile with
?entry=<path>to preview a single file; if it has no\documentclass, Quillo borrowsmain.tex's preamble. - Always finish by compiling (verify the PDF builds) and then unlocking.

- Session cookie
quillo_session(14 days) for the web UI. - Bearer API token (
quillo_…, only its SHA-256 hash is stored) for external tools and AI agents — same permissions as the cookie. - Tokens are per-user and singular: issuing a new one revokes the previous.
